What You’ll Do as an CLV Safety Associate:
- Monitor the safety of the campus, residents, staff, and visitors.
- Conduct routine patrols and inspections of buildings and grounds.
- Respond promptly to emergencies, alarms, and resident assistance calls.
- Transport staff or residents within campus grounds as requested.
- Document incidents and maintain accurate reports.
- Assist with enforcing community safety policies and procedures.
- Communicate effectively with residents, team members, and emergency personnel when necessary.
- Provide excellent customer service while promoting a safe and welcoming environment.
